  • Custom designed and built by Gator Pit of Texas for the United States Navy. Voted "Top Ten Coolest Pit". This is the Flagship of Gator Pit. Two adults can stand in the upright. Some 30 feet long, 8 feet wide, 13 feet tall and 10,150 pounds of steel. For more information contact Gator Pit of Texas WWW.GATORPIT.NET

    How a cooker's air flow is managed depends on it's overall design. On our Gators, no problem. Air intake vents, firebox size, hole between firebox and food chamber, stack placement, size stack, height of stack, etc all play an integral part in the flow or distribution of air through out the cooker. Our design does not have any air flow issues. No restrictions to cause stale smoke/ heat control issues. Stacks fully open and our air intake vents on the firebox open and you will be just fine.
